Transaction 3331520e74ec84c74b322dcdec20c7274748dd591a484e14967df3b5572d92dc

2 Input
2 Outputs
  • 3331520e74ec84c74b322dcdec20c7274748dd591a484e14967df3b5572d92dc:0
  • value  500713
    address  bc1q3vdlpq9lgq6rjy9q4gqe3te6kq5lpkklzkujux
  • 3331520e74ec84c74b322dcdec20c7274748dd591a484e14967df3b5572d92dc:1
  • value  424099
    address  3FyghQShN9ezPqx4eLQX9255aWjDwPeFCb